The Airey Award


2007 winner – Carlos M. Díaz

“In recognition of 50 years of achievement in copper-nickel research, industrial development, education in pyrometallurgy and for his pioneering leadership in the copper-nickel industry”.





Carlos Díaz was educated at the University of Chile, Columbia University (MSc), and the Imperial College of the University of London (DIC, PhD). He taught chemical thermodynamics and extractive metallurgy at the University of Chile, where he also held the positions of Head of the Department of Mining and Director of the School of Engineering. In 1975, he joined Inco Limited. In his capacity as Head of the Pyrometallurgy Section of the J.R. Gordon Research Laboratory, he was responsible for research leading to new copper and nickel smelting and converting processes. He retired from Inco in 1997. At present, he is Director of the Centre for Chemical Process Metallurgy, an industry-university cooperative research organization, based at the University of Toronto, where he is also an adjunct professor in the Department of Materials Science and Engineering.


Carlos was actively involved in the organization of Copper 87, the first of the Copper-Cobre series of international conferences, and on each of the succeeding copper conferences. He is the author or co-author of a book on the thermodynamic properties of copper smelting slag systems, more than 50 technical papers and 15 patents of invention, and co-editor of numerous international conference proceedings, including several of the Copper-Cobre conferences. He is a past-president of the Metallurgical Society of CIM, a fellow of CIM and a member of the Chilean Institute of Mining Engineers. Carlos Díaz is the recipient of Canadian, Chilean and American awards.
